The process of making a histogram using the given data is described below Step 1 Choose a suitable scale to represent weights on the horizontal axis. Step 2 Choose a suitable scale to represent the frequencies on the vertical axis. Step 3 Then draw the bars corresponding to each of the given weights using their frequencies. 3. Create a histogram chart. Select Column E Bins and Column F Frequency. Go to Insert Column Chart Clustered Column. Right-click the bars and select Format Data Series. Set Gap Width to 0 to make it look like a histogram. 4. Customize the chart as needed. Using the FREQUENCY function for dynamic histograms
